Nilmar Janbu

Nilmar Oskar Charles Janbu (born August 23, 1921 in Nordre Bjørnsund on Bjørnsund in Fræna ( Norway ); † January 4, 2013 in Trondheim ) was a Norwegian civil engineer and a pioneer in soil mechanics. Janbu was professor of geotechnics at the Norwegian Technical University in Trondheim (NTH).

After graduating from high school in 1941, Janbu studied architecture and then civil engineering at the NTH and made his civil engineering diploma in 1947. He then worked as an assistant at the Institute for Statics, before going on a scholarship to Harvard University in 1948 to teach the then leading soil mechanics Arthur Casagrande and Karl von Terzaghi . He earned his masters degree in 1949 and then began writing his PhD thesis at Harvard, which was defended in 1954. In it he dealt with a method that goes beyond the slip circle method for the verification of slope stability, which also allows more general slip curves to be treated as circles and straight lines, one of his best-known works. Since the scholarship had expired, he went back to Oslo before completing his dissertation, where he first worked for a construction company and then from 1952 at the newly founded Geotechnical Institute (headed by Laurits Bjerrum ). He headed its branch and laboratory in Trondheim. From 1961 he was professor for geotechnics at the NTH in Trondheim. He has given guest lectures at numerous universities around the world. His construction projects include Kansai Airport in Japan and Gardermoen Airport in Oslo.

In 1985 he was a Rankine Lecturer . He was an honorary member of the Norwegian Geotechnical Society (whose Laurits Bjerrum Prize he received), a member of the Norwegian Academy of Engineering Sciences and the Norwegian Academy of Sciences. He received the Austen B. Mason Prize from Harvard University.

More than 130 scientific publications come from him and he trained numerous geotechnicians in Trondheim.
